The **Immunoglobulin superfamily containing leucine-rich repeat protein (ISLR)** is a 428-amino acid extracellular and membrane-associated protein that combines immunoglobulin-like (IgSF) domains with multiple leucine-rich repeat (LRR) motifs. The protein is highly expressed in mesenchymal stromal/stem cells, brown adipose tissue, skeletal muscle, and multiple other tissues including retina, heart, ovary, and testis. ISLR functions in cell adhesion, signaling within the extracellular matrix, and regulation of mitochondrial activity and energy homeostasis. Mechanistically, ISLR interacts with Ndufs2 to modulate IL-6 signaling, acting as a brake to prevent excess brown fat activation following muscle injury, thereby affecting whole-body energy expenditure and thermogenesis. Because of its regulatory role in muscle-adipose tissue communication and metabolic function, ISLR represents a promising novel target for metabolic disease therapeutics, although direct pharmacological targeting has not yet reached clinical application. Additionally, ISLR may serve as a marker for specific stem cell populations and is involved in developmental processes.
Modulates IL-6 signaling by interacting with NADH:Ubiquinone oxidoreductase core subunit S2 (Ndufs2)\nActs as a brake on muscle-derived IL-6, limiting brown adipose tissue activation and thermogenesis
